Output e8dc801f8273f594a01bbe35127f55caa58a8b9b854b8f613910fdf73caf0ad8:1

value
4363741146
script pubkey
OP_0 OP_PUSHBYTES_20 0b9ad041217e26896a15417bbbd0a932521be6aa
address
tb1qpwddqsfp0cngj6s4g9amh59fxffphe428rpauk
transaction
e8dc801f8273f594a01bbe35127f55caa58a8b9b854b8f613910fdf73caf0ad8
confirmations
108033
spent
true